Common Toilet Problems and How to Fix Them

Toilets can develop several issues over time. Some common problems include:

      Clogged Toilets: A blockage can cause water to overflow. Using a plunger can often solve this problem. For stubborn clogs, a drain snake may be needed.

      Leaky Seals: The wax ring at the base of the toilet can wear out. This can cause water to leak onto the floor. Replacing the seal can fix this issue.

      Weak Flush: If the flush is not powerful enough, the problem may be in the tank. Adjusting the water level or cleaning the flush holes can help.

      Running Water: A faulty flapper or fill valve can cause constant running water. Replacing these parts can stop the issue and save water.

How to Keep Your Toilet in Good Condition

Regular maintenance helps avoid costly repairs. Here are a few simple tips:

      Avoid flushing non-flushable items: Paper towels, wipes, and hygiene products can clog the toilet.

      Check for leaks: If you notice a sudden increase in your water bill, check for leaks in the toilet.

      Clean the toilet regularly: This prevents buildup and keeps it working smoothly.

      Test the flush system: If the flush is weak, check the water level and clean any blockages.
